Mouse Immunoglobulin G2b (IgG2b) ELISA Kit-Sandwich
Product Overview
BioVenic Mouse Immunoglobulin G2b (IgG2b) ELISA Kit-Sandwich is designed for the quantitative determination of Mouse IgG2b in serum, plasma, tissue homogenate, cell culture supernatant, cell lysate, and other biological fluids using a Sandwich ELISA method. For research use only.

Target Information
IgG2b engages in immune effector functions by binding to specific Fc receptors, such as FcγRIII and FcRIV. For instance, research indicates that IgG2b regulates immune responses in mice through these receptor interactions, contributing to the defense against viral and parasitic infections. Notably, IgG2b levels increase after mice are infected with Toxocara canis, potentially linked to the regulation of mixed Th1/Th2 responses. IgG2b can also mitigate inflammatory responses and the polarization of M2 macrophages by binding to CD32b (FcγRIIb) produced by TGF-β, thus offering protection in conditions like atherosclerosis. Furthermore, IgG2b helps protect mice by reducing inflammation and plaque formation. With a rapid metabolic rate and a short half-life of approximately 5 days, IgG2b acts swiftly in acute immune responses but is limited in sustaining long-term immune memory.
